    Job Summary
    Develops new software. Develops and directs software system testing and validation procedures, programming, and documentation.

    Responsibilities
    Work in a globally distributed development team on Hybrid Multi-Cloud Networking

    Develop Terraform Plans, Ansible scripts to provision the infrastructure on Azure, AWS, GCP, etc. and make it open source to help community

    Automate and Test Terraform scripts using Golang, Terratest framework

    Develop and maintain API Test automation framework

    Design, build and coordinate an automated build & release CI/CD process using GHA.


    Cultivate Equinix's open-source presence and reputation in open-source organizations, standards bodies and more like Cloud Native Computing Foundation (CNCF), Linux Foundation, etc.

    Interact with stakeholder(s) to understand and document the product feature(s)

    Hands-on Architecture, Design, Development, Automation Testing & Support of Software Products and Solutions

    Qualifications
    Bachelor's degree in computer science, Software Engineering, or related field with 3+ years of professional software development experience

    Minimum 1+ years of expertise in Go, Terraform Providers, CLI, Ansible, Python,Pulumi

    Minimum 1+ years of experience in Developing Terraform scripts

    Minimum 1+ years of hands-on experience in testing Terraform scripts through Go Lang, Terratest, Terragrunt framework

    Preferred experience with setting up Kubernetes (Container Orchestration), Istio (service-mesh), Nginx on Bare-Metal servers using Python, Ansible, CLI, Terraform interfaces

    Hands-on experience with continuous integration and delivery using a public cloud such as AWS, Azure, or GCP and container technologies such as Docker, Rancher, etc

    Experience with database technologies (NoSQL, SQL and Timeseries Databases)

    Experience developing and maintaining an API Test automation framework

    Experience with Agile software development practices including Scrum, JIRA, Peer Review, Git and CI/CD

    Strong programming foundation with knowledge of Data Structures, Algorithms, and Design Patterns

    Good to have knowledge on OpenAPI specs, SwaggerHub, SDK generation processes through OpenAPI Tools

    Good to have experience is API contract testing and Pact framework

    DevOps mindset to improve CICD using GitHub Actions (GHA)

    The targeted pay range for this position in the following location is / locations are:
    San Francisco, CA /

    Bay Area:
    $111,000 to $185,000 per year

    California (Non-SF/Bay Area), Connecticut, Maryland, New York, New Jersey, Washington state: $104,000 to $172,000 per year

    Colorado, Nevada, Rhode Island:
    $94,000 to $156,000 per year


    Our pay ranges reflect the minimum and maximum target for new hire pay for the full-time position determined by role, level, and location.

    Individual pay is based on additional factors including job-related skills, experience, and relevant education and/or training.

    This position may be offered in other locations. Your recruiter can share more about the specific pay range for your preferred location during the hiring process.

    The targeted pay range listed reflects the base pay only and does not include bonus, equity, or benefits. Employees are eligible for bonus, and equity may be offered depending on the position.
